Coupon Terms & Abbreviations to Know

BOGO or B1G1 = Buy One, Get One Free

Catalina = checkout coupon

DND = Do Not Double

GM = General Mills coupon insert

OYNO = on your next order

PG = Procter & Gamble coupon insert

RP = RedPlum coupon insert

SS = SmartSource coupon insert

WYB = When You Buy
